Output dd8bfca266cf03d4a680ddece3b6a43028c14d9a3a47371a7f948846171ac688:0

value
22389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ed196fe787422e68da5e0fc2d895d8cc35e5543 OP_EQUAL
address
3QvNdpnYny1gVhwRxexBE2mtcvCvSA2AH2
transaction
dd8bfca266cf03d4a680ddece3b6a43028c14d9a3a47371a7f948846171ac688